Take a look at the announcement trailer for The 9th Dragon, an upcoming side-scroller beat ’em up action adventure game. The 9th Dragon combines tactical combat with a dynamic free-style beat โ€˜em up approach as players navigate the gritty neon maze of Kowloon as Rookie, the newest member of an elite police commando unit. Players will shape the narrative to go either way – will Rookie be a hero, or not? It all depends on the decisions made throughout the story. You can learn more about The 9th Dragon on Steam if you’re interested: https://store.steampowered.com/app/4402330/The_9th_Dragon/The 9th Dragon will be available on PC (Epic Games Store and Steam), PlayStation, Xbox, and Nintendo Switch.
